What Are Cable Carrier Trays?
Cable carrier trays, commonly referred to as cable trays, are systems designed to support insulated electrical cables used for power distribution and communication. These trays come in various designs and materials, including metal, fiberglass, and plastic, catering to diverse applications and environments. They can be classified into different types, such as ladder trays, solid bottom trays, channel trays, and wire mesh trays, each serving specific needs based on cable type, load capacity, and installation conditions.
Benefits of Using Cable Carrier Trays
1. Organized Cable Management One of the primary advantages of cable trays is their ability to keep cables organized and accessible. By allowing for a neat arrangement of wires, they prevent tangling and damage, which can result from poorly managed cables. This organization also simplifies maintenance and upgrades, as technicians can easily identify and access specific cables when necessary.
2. Enhanced Safety Improperly managed cables pose serious safety hazards, including the risk of electrical fires and trip hazards. Cable trays help mitigate these risks by providing a secure and orderly arrangement for wires. Additionally, they often come equipped with covers or cages, adding an extra layer of protection against accidental contact and environmental factors.

3. Versatility Cable trays are incredibly versatile. They can be used in various settings, including commercial buildings, industrial plants, data centers, and even residential applications. Their adaptability allows them to accommodate a range of cable types, from power cables to fiber optics, making them suitable for any project needing cable management solutions.
4. Easy Installation and Modification The installation process for cable trays is generally straightforward. They can be mounted on walls, ceilings, or even used as freestanding structures. This ease of installation is complemented by the flexibility to modify the layout as needs change. As technology evolves and new cable types emerge, adjustments can be made without significant disruption.
5. Reduced Downtime In critical environments such as data centers and manufacturing facilities, downtime can be costly. Cable trays facilitate quicker troubleshooting and maintenance, as technicians can easily locate and assess the condition of cables. This proactive management ultimately leads to reduced downtime and enhanced operational efficiency.
6. Cost-Effectiveness While there may be an initial investment in cable trays, the long-term savings they provide are undeniable. By preventing damage to cables and reducing maintenance time, businesses can save on replacement costs and labor expenses. Furthermore, the extended lifespan of properly managed cables means fewer replacements over time.
